Output 25ff2c066291e3559e21f0f37a9da8c6a42591dfa30a39bd8876827091931154:0

value
537786
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b14af9dabbcd6ef37799be61c226379392e85d03 OP_EQUALVERIFY OP_CHECKSIG
address
1HASRNtTSPcWD6pKErmUyzE7B67DCWnSHb
transaction
25ff2c066291e3559e21f0f37a9da8c6a42591dfa30a39bd8876827091931154
spent
true